.block-content-type-label_and_text_block {
  background: linear-gradient(90deg, #ED002F 0.02%, #AB192D 76.52%);
  margin-top: 48px;
}

@media (min-width: 768px) {
  .block-content-type-label_and_text_block {
    margin-top: 96px;
  }
}

.block-content-type-label_and_text_block .block-container {
  display: flex;
  width: 100%;
  flex-direction: column;
  justify-content: center;
  align-items: flex-start;
  font-weight: 300;
  font-size: 16px;
  line-height: 20px;
  color: #ffffff;
  margin: 64px auto 0;
  gap: 8px;
  padding: 20px;
}

@media (min-width: 744px) {
  .block-content-type-label_and_text_block .block-container {
    padding: 24px 40px;
  }
}

@media (min-width: 1360px) {
  .block-content-type-label_and_text_block .block-container {
    padding: 24px 96px;
  }
}

@media (min-width: 1440px) {
  .block-content-type-label_and_text_block .block-container {
    max-width: 1440px;
  }
}

.block-content-type-label_and_text_block .field--name-body {
  display: flex;
  flex-direction: column;
  align-items: flex-start;
  align-self: stretch;
  gap: 8px;
}

.block-content-type-label_and_text_block .field--name-body::after {
  display: none;
}

.block-content-type-label_and_text_block .field--name-body p {
  color: #ffffff;
  line-height: 20px;
  margin: 0;
}

.block-content-type-label_and_text_block .block-label {
  display: flex;
  justify-content: center;
  align-items: center;
  gap: 4px;
  padding: 4px 8px;
  border-radius: 16px;
  background: #00bf9e;
  width: fit-content;
  font-weight: 500;
}

.block-content-type-label_and_text_block .block-label::before {
  content: "";
  display: inline-block;
  width: 16px;
  height: 16px;
  background-repeat: no-repeat;
  background-size: contain;
  background-image: url("data:image/svg+xml;utf8,<svg viewBox='0 0 24 24' xmlns='http://www.w3.org/2000/svg'><path fill='white' d='M6.6 10.8a15.05 15.05 0 006.6 6.6l2.2-2.2a1 1 0 011-.24c1.1.36 2.3.56 3.6.56a1 1 0 011 1V21a1 1 0 01-1 1C10.07 22 2 13.93 2 4a1 1 0 011-1h3.5a1 1 0 011 1c0 1.3.2 2.5.56 3.6a1 1 0 01-.25 1l-2.2 2.2z'/></svg>");
}

/*# sourceMappingURL=../../../maps/library-components/layout/blocks/block-label-and-text-block.css.map */
